Indigo Bunting rescue

Laura and I were upstairs looking out the big windows and I saw the brightest bluest bird on the feeder. At first I thought it was a mountain bluebird. It turns out I was able to get a closer look and was able to determin that it was infact an Indigo Bunting. As it left the feeder it flew right in our direction and hit the window. We both screamed and I grabbed my little camera and headed outside. I was able to snap a few pics before I sat it on a branch at the edge of the woods. We watched it for a while and then flew away! =) I hope he stays around for the summer! We later saw it back at my feeder next to a bright red cardinal and a beautiful yellow American Goldfinch!! What a sight to see those bright colors all sharing a meal at my feeder!! I used to have a Painted Bunting that hung around my old house in Florida, now that is a colorful bird!
